Funny you should ask that, Scott. Alien Skin Software today introduced Exposure. Part of this Photoshop plug-in is a suite of filters that emulate the look of specific films. Kodachrome 25 is there. They even have a filter to emulate the old GAF 500 slide film from the 70s!! The other part of the suite emulates a wide variety of black and white films. I've been playing with a pre-release version for a little while and have had great fun converting some of my digital shots and scans to the looks of a variety of old films. I just checked and don't see the info on their web site yet, but it should be up later today since this is the embargo date they gave us. www.alienskin.com

Looks interesting, but to my mind, $199 is a lot of money to pay for a few photoshop actions or PSP scripts - personally I'd rather put the effort into creating the exact effect I want, rather than pay for someone else's attempt at duplicating the effects of a few old films.
